Product details
The Deemax Park 26 wheels from Mavic are specifically designed for downhill use, offering an excellent combination of performance and durability. These front wheels are ideal for challenging trails and provide an optimal riding experience both uphill and downhill. With a thoughtful design and robust construction, the Deemax Park 26 wheels are built to withstand the challenges of mountain biking. They feature a 20 x 110 mm axle system that ensures easy installation and a stable hold. Weighing 995 grams per wheel, they strike a good balance between stability and agility, making them an excellent choice for anyone seeking adventure off-road.
- Designed for downhill use
- Compatible with 6-bolt disc brakes
- Robust construction for high loads.
